A Touching Story: Two Kittens Cried Despaired Next to Their Dying Mother Until a Dog Brought Me to Help

It was a quiet, cloudy morning when my dog started acting strangely during our walk. His ears perked up, and he kept tugging at the leash, whining and pulling toward the bushes near an old shed. I almost ignored it, thinking he was just curious—but something in his behavior told me to follow. And I’m so glad I did.

As we approached, I heard faint cries—high-pitched, desperate, and heartbreaking. Hidden behind the tall grass were two tiny kittens, barely a week old, curled up next to their mother who lay motionless. Their eyes were barely open, their fur soaked from the morning dew, and their cries—oh, their cries—were full of despair. They were nudging their mother, hoping she would respond. But she didn’t. She was weak and barely breathing, clearly at the edge of her life.

The kittens were so small, so fragile, yet clinging to the only comfort they knew: their fading mom. It broke my heart.

My dog gently sniffed the scene, then looked at me, almost like he was pleading, “Please do something.” Without wasting a second, I carefully picked up the kittens and wrapped them in a warm towel. I gently touched the mother cat—she opened her eyes slightly, as if to acknowledge that help had finally come.

I rushed them to a nearby animal clinic. Sadly, the mother cat passed not long after. But because of my dog’s instincts and insistence, her babies were saved just in time. The vet said they were dehydrated and cold, but strong enough to survive with care.

Now those two kittens are safe, bottle-fed, and warm every night. I think about their cries often—how they didn’t give up, how a dog became their unlikely hero, and how love can cross all kinds of boundaries.

It’s a moment I’ll never forget—a touching story of sorrow, hope, and a dog’s heart that led me to save two tiny lives.
